During our last two AmeriCorps State and National monthly recruitment calls, a question was raised about whether currently serving members can accept gift cards or other monetary incentives for referring prospective members to apply and/or serve.

Use of AmeriCorps grant funding for recruitment and retention incentives/performance awards are allowable to the extent they are:

  1. reasonable, necessary, and allowable for program outcomes;
  2. tied to the program narrative;
  3. fair;
  4. consistently applied; and
  5. part of the organization’s written policies and procedures.

Please contact your portfolio manager with any additional questions about what is allowable.
